The Neurosurgery Surgical Rhoton Round Dissector – 1 mm, 19 cm, Angled Titanium is a premium-quality microsurgical instrument designed for neurosurgeons and skull base specialists who require maximum precision during delicate operative procedures. Manufactured from high-grade titanium, this dissector offers lightweight handling, excellent durability, corrosion resistance, and superior performance in demanding microsurgical environments.
Featuring a 1 mm round dissecting tip, 19 cm overall length, and an angled shaft design, this instrument provides excellent access to deep and narrow surgical fields. The smooth rounded tip allows controlled blunt dissection, tissue separation, and gentle manipulation while helping preserve delicate anatomical structures. The angled configuration improves visualization and instrument positioning during complex neurosurgical approaches.
The titanium construction offers significant advantages for microsurgical applications, including reduced instrument weight, enhanced balance, excellent biocompatibility, and resistance to corrosion. This makes the Rhoton Round Dissector particularly suitable for prolonged procedures requiring precise movements and minimal hand fatigue.
The ergonomically balanced handle provides a secure grip with outstanding tactile feedback, allowing surgeons to perform controlled movements with confidence. The satin finish minimizes glare under operating microscopes and surgical lighting, improving visibility and procedural accuracy.
Designed for repeated professional use, the Rhoton Round Dissector – 1 mm, 19 cm, Angled Titanium is fully reusable and autoclavable. Its precision manufacturing ensures reliable performance through repeated sterilization cycles, making it an essential instrument for neurosurgical, skull base, and microsurgical instrument collections.

Product Specifications
| Specification | Details |
|---|---|
| Product Name | Neurosurgery Surgical Rhoton Round Dissector |
| Tip Size | 1 mm Round Tip |
| Length | 19 cm |
| Design | Angled |
| Material | Titanium |
| Instrument Type | Microsurgical Dissector |
| Finish | Satin / Matte Finish |
| Sterilization | Fully Autoclavable |
| Reusable | Yes |
| Corrosion Resistant | Yes |
| Specialty | Neurosurgery, Skull Base Surgery, Microsurgery |
| Application | Tissue Dissection, Tissue Separation & Microsurgical Manipulation |
